| The former U.S. Vice President Al Gore, who is not only a well-known American statesman but also a Nobel Peace Prize winner, devotes himself to the theoretical research and dissemination in environmental protection. After analyzed the roots of ecological crisis, Al Gore proposed the solution to the environmental crisis by global cooperation."The Marshall Plan of Global environmental"drafted by Gore and his concept of "carbon trading" have been hot topics in the field of the environment and economy. Gore's thinking of environmental protection has provided a direction and blueprint for solving global ecological crisis.
